Abstract
This paper proposes an evaluation method of the travel time reliability of public transportation network. The method uses a transit assignment model incorporating the capacity constraints and the correlation of the vehicles, where passengers are firstly assigned to a network with the norm of expected waiting time and then travel time reliability is evaluated using the expected waiting time from the output of the model. Since the travel times between stops are assumed to be constant, the sources of fluctuations of the travel time in this study are the waiting times at the stop which depend on the congestion and the correlation among vehicles. Finally, the proposed method is applied to a toy network to demonstrate how the overcapacity and the correlation of vehicles affect travel time reliability.
